The residence is one of only three distinctive homes within 109 Willow Street, a nearly 9,000-square-foot Colonial Revival mansion built in 1905 by architect John Petit. Each home preserves elements of the property's original character while offering the comfort, quality, and functionality of a complete modern renovation.
Featured in the Rizzoli classic "Bricks and Brownstone," 109 Willow Street is an exceptional example of the early-20th-century Colonial Revival houses inspired by the elegant row houses of the early 1800s. Its beautifully restored exterior showcases a classic red-brick facade, marble entrance stoop and doorway, limestone window surrounds, and original wooden shutters.
